Transaction 170f55eea3c2ff4b2b3b32dd5c789caa4119377b7ea2696eb997ae7af2886812

2 Input
2 Outputs
  • 170f55eea3c2ff4b2b3b32dd5c789caa4119377b7ea2696eb997ae7af2886812:0
  • value  400000000
    address  3FZB79HAXTRWPK2z3mxwkve3CUdb6aD2Ue
  • 170f55eea3c2ff4b2b3b32dd5c789caa4119377b7ea2696eb997ae7af2886812:1
  • value  68804917
    address  3M6rSjiaX6c8NqekonVpCPiuy7FdyA5wd2